Name: Jay Hoh on Jan 15, 2013Comments: Just a note: This petition follows a 5 month effort that included a rider survey in which 95% of 50+ Seniors said that they did not mind competing against 40+ Masters in a single class. 93% of those surveyed preferred paying two sanctioning fees rather than have split classes/split paybacks. Our club asked for approval of show with IBRA sanction fees refunded to NBHA members who requested it. Then NBHA changed the rule to absolutely no co-sanctioning. Then they got so much heat they made it a regional director decision - strange for a national organization. But our regional director produces big shows that compete with our shows only hours away, so, BINGO, no co-sanctioning allowed in our region. Conflict of interest, perhaps? Just hoping that they live up to the second line of their rulebook: "Our goals are to increase the number of participants, improve the quality of shows and enhance the image of barrel racing."Flag

Name: Sandra A Brewer on Jan 16, 2013Comments: I belong to a small district with minimal arenas available to us. We have been able to co-sanction with other association which allows us to draw a larger participant entry. Many of the barrel racers belong to numerous associations and by allowing co-sanctioning, they can continue to run for points and not have to choose. In this time of economic variance, we are not able to travel and spend the money on fuel like we use to. Allowing co-sanctioning between associations and committees, helps the pocketbook and continues to promote everyone. If the problem is sanctioning fees, then derive a plan in which NBHA will always get something.Flag
